Transponder Keys

Nissan keys are equipped with transponder chips on the majority of models. These chips disable the vehicle's immobilizer mechanism so that nobody else can start it without your consent. This system can save a lot of money on repair and replacement car keys nissan costs.

There are two types of transponder key that are available: rolling code and Crypto. Transponders that utilize rolling code transmit data both to and from the key, and to the car's computer. The car's computer checks the data transmitted by the key and then alters the chip's code. This is done in a safe manner, so that no one could steal the data.

Crypto transponders transfer data in a more private manner. The keys are encrypted and cannot be copied. However, there are ways around this. The owner's guide for the Nissan Rogue states that the car comes with the "key-number plate." This is tiny metal tag which is placed on a flat, tiny part of your key. The key number plate can be used to duplicate a replacement key in case you've lost the original. It is important to keep the key number plate with care.

Key Batteries

It's quite simple to swap the battery inside your key fob. The majority of nissan car key copy key fobs use a standard, coin-sized, disc-shaped battery called a CR2032 or CR2025 (the numbers indicate the battery's size). These batteries are readily available in any retailer that sells regular coin-sized batteries. They last a long time, too, since they are used in a passive manner and don't make any connections to the car.

Key Cutting

Nissan produces cars and vans that come with a variety keys. The older vehicles, which are usually in the early 2000s, use a conventional metal key and an ordinary lock. A locksmith in your area can cut a new key for these vehicles however, the keys will not contain a transponder which disables your vehicle's immobiliser and allows you to start it.

Modern cars equipped with keyless entry and push-to-start systems have transponder chips inside the head of the key, which is programmed to the immobiliser system in the vehicle. It is essential to find a specialist auto locksmith with the right tools for programming keys to create this kind of key.
